At Lung Saskatchewan we work to deliver on our mission: to improve lung health one breath at a time. Our commitment to improving lung health in Saskatchewan began in 1911 during the tuberculosis epidemic that swept across the province and Canada. Today, we continue to fight for the 1 in 5 people in Canada affected by lung diseases such as asthma,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, pulmonary fibrosis, lung cancer, sleep apnea and now COVID-19.    

Thanks to our work, Saskatchewan has seen tremendous strides in lung health education, research, health promotion, and advocacy. It is through these four priorities we are able to offer best-in-class, timely, and relevant opportunities to all of our stakeholders.    

At Lung Saskatchewan we are committed to investing in lung health research happening in Saskatchewan, and we work to advance lung health priorities at the municipal, provincial, and federal level.  Our programs and services focus on protecting lung health, preventing lung disease, and ensuring that the resources are available for people who need them.
